For the benefit of North American viewers (where the National Trust is a financial organisation) it should be explained that the UK NT is a NGO dedicated to the preservation of historic buildings and outstanding scenery. The NT owns a lot of the Lake District -- in fact, it began there with the support of, among others, Beatrix Potter (whose house at Hilltop is now NT property). The National Trust has links with Heritage Canada and has a US branch called, I believe, the Royal Oak Foundation (or something similar -- an oak leaf is the NT symbol).
